Boeing finds out new president won’t just pay whatever defense contractors want
Canada Free Press ^ | 12/07/17 | Dan Calabrese

Posted on 12/07/2016 9:15:49 AM PST by Sean_Anthony

Not even for Air Force One

Defense contractors were pretty excited when Donald Trump won the election, figuring it was fat and happy time once again for defense spending. And if happy time means the Pentagon will once again be willing to fund what the nation needs for its defense, then there should indeed by plenty of smiles to go around.

As for the fat part, defense contractors are used to the idea that cost overruns are no issue with the Pentagon because whatever they order they have to have, and have right away. The cost-is-no-object approach to national security is understandable in a certain sense, but when contractors know they can go hog wild with no consequences . . . well, they’re going to go hog wild. Frequently.
